A train travels from station A to C having distance of 285 miles in 6 hours. During the journey, it reaches intermediate station B at the average speed of 40 miles/hr. From station B, train reaches station C at average speed of 55 miles/hr. What is the distance between the station B and C?

Answer:

Distance between B and C =
3* 55=165miles

Explanation:

Let the time taken to reach from station A to B be x hr

Let the time taken to reach from station B to C be y hr

Given total time from station A to C be 6 hr

∴ x + y = 6

⇒ y = 6 - x → (1)

Also total distance given is 285 miles

As
Distance=Speed* Time

∴ distance travelled between station A and B

=
40* xmiles

distance travelled between station B and station C

=
55* ymiles

So, 40x + 55y = 285

⇒ 40x + 55(6 -x) = 285 (From 1)

=> 40x + 330 - 55x = 285

=> -15x = 285 - 330

=> -15x = -45 ⇒ x=3

gives y = 6-3 = 3 hours


Distance between B and C =
3* 55=165miles
